728x90
app.get('/edit/:id', function(요청, 응답){
db.collection('feData').findOne({_id : parseInt(요청.params.id)}, function(에러,결과){
// url 파라미터 중 :id 를 가져와주세요.
// 여기서 id 값을 String 값이기 때문에 정수로 바꾸어주어야한다.
console.log(결과)
if(결과==null){
응답.render('nox.ejs', {data:결과})
}else{
응답.render('edit.ejs', {data:결과})
}
})
});
'feData' 에 DB 이름을 적어주자.
'코딩 > 웹페이지 만들기' 카테고리의 다른 글
DB 데이터 인풋 & 아웃풋 (0) | 2021.06.21 |
---|---|
node.js 웹서버 설치 (0) | 2021.06.21 |
보이지 않는 input 을 삽입해서 데이터 전달하기 (0) | 2021.06.20 |
HTML5 에서 PUT/DELETE 요청하기 (0) | 2021.06.20 |
DB 에서 데이터 받아온 후 ejs 호출 시 전달하는 법 (0) | 2021.06.20 |
댓글